State of the conduction electrons and the work function of a metal
B. V. Vasilieva, M. I. Kaganovb, V. L. Lyuboshitsc a Institute for Physico-Technical Problems
b P. L. Kapitza Institute for Physical Problems, Russian Academy of Sciences, Moscow
c Joint Institute for Nuclear Research, Dubna, Moscow region
Abstract:
The condition for a minimum of the bulk energy of a metal is used to determine the chemical potential of the conduction electrons. This potential is measured from the value of the energy far from the metal and is equal (with the opposite sign) to its work function. Suggestions are made as to the reasons why a very simplistic description of the problem leads to results that do not conflict with the experimental data.
